Summary

Using the set of exercises and model answers for each module, learners can test their knowledge of the syllabus. Starting at a basic level, learners can progress to a more advanced level, developing and progressing their skills as they work.

Checklists at the start of each exercise mean candidates can assess which skills are needed to complete the task. Progressive exercises let candidates work at their own pace and gradually build up the experience and skills they need to pass the exam. Each exercise is cross-referenced back to the syllabus. Model answers help learners to assess their own work. Written by an experienced trainer to offer peace of mind about the quality of the content.

About Jackie Sherman

Jackie Sherman has been involved in teaching and assessing IT courses at further education colleges since 1996. She also trains staff in an education department and writes courses for distance learning colleges. Her on-line activities include being on the National Tutor Database for LearnDirect and answering IT questions for the YouCanDoIT column of www.laterlife.com. Jackie is ECDL qualified and is the author of two successful IT books.
